I was in Warri days ago.The oil city along with her twin sister Effurun are facing impressive make over of Oborevwori’s touch.

When the magnificent mega bridges with paved roads are completed soon,both areas and satellite settlements would experience socio economic boost.

The massive Julius Berger work in Warri axis,unprecedented in grandeur may not have drawn much attention but history would someday advertise the nobility of Oborevwori in scaling up to befitting standards the status of one of Nigeria’s most neglected but iconic cities.

Elsewhere the Ode-Itsekiri bridge transversing several communities and Beneku bridge down Delta North have received appreciable respite.

Worth documenting are the completion of the Delta Court complex headquarters at Asaba,the strategic Okpanam -Ibusa road,first phase of Emevor-Orogun road as well spirited efforts on the Ughelli – Oleh- Ogwashi Uku expressway. Across Delta towns and villages, spanning Urhobo, Itsekiri, Ibo,Isoko and Ijaw, projects are visible whether completed or developing.

The Oborevwori administration is providing the essential needs of Delta state university and three others at Anwai-Asaba,Agbor and Ozoro, to make them competitive citadels of learning.

Taking governance to the grassroots,each of the 25 local government areas in Delta has a development lifeline of 2billion Naira in the current state appropriation.

Beyond infrastructure, Oborevwori’s eyes are also on the social welfare of the people he leads.

Figures don’t lie. A record number of over 250,000 persons have been helped to gain footing in entrepreneurship under the state’s D-Cares programme. Various government agencies had recently rolled out grants and occupational tools to aid youths establish their businesses and earn responsible wealth.

Delta civil servants are among the most rewarded in the 36 states of the federation.They get their monthly salaries regularly with the new minimum wage implemented. Political appointees get their entitlements.The governor is not indebted.
